All-Time(last 40 years)

First Team

G Larry Hughes

G David Burns 19.4 ppg 54.8% fg '79-81

F Joe Wiley 17.5 ppg 9.6 rpg '67-70

F Harry Rogers 18.4 ppg '70-73

C Anthony Bonner 14.8 ppg 10.7 rpg '86-90

Second Team

G Justin Love 16.3 ppg 80% ft '99-00

G Erwin Clagett 16.5 ppg '92-95

F Roland Gray 14.6 ppg 45.7 3-pt '85-89

F Donnie Dobbs 16.6 ppg '92-94

C Kelvin Henderson 14.6 ppg 110 blocks '78-80

Third Team

G H Waldman 42.0 3-pt 125 steals/295 assists '94-95

G Jimmy Irving 15.7 ppg '68-71

F Monroe Douglas 14.7 ppg 78% ft '85-89

F Lewis McKinney 17.2 ppg '73-76

C Billy Morris 15.9 ppg '73-75
